Engagement Activity Needs Your Support

Edison PTSA student member Sarah Staresina is working on an engagement activity for her global politics class about the challenges faced by refugees in our community. As part of her project, she would like to bring attention to an online wishlist for the organization, Women for Afghan Women–the Virginia Community Center. This wishlist contains a variety of household items needed by recently arrived refugees as they begin their new life in the U.S.

Two EHS Students have won in the National PTA Reflections Art Program

Two students who submitted works to the Reflections Art Program have won at the local level and have progressed to the district level for judging. Victoria B won Outstanding Interpretation for her High School photography entry. Her photograph will be moving on to compete at the Virginia state level. Aiden Riley won Award of Excellence for his Special Artist photography entry. Victoria B also won the Award for Merit for her literature entry. Congratulations to both Victoria and Aiden on a job well done.
